Chatbot

Quick Answer

A chatbot is a software application that engages in conversation with users via text or voice. Modern AI-powered chatbots can answer questions, perform actions, escalate complex issues, and learn from each interaction to improve over time.

In Depth

What Chatbot really means

Traditional chatbots followed scripted decision trees and broke easily when users phrased things unexpectedly. LLM-powered chatbots handle natural language gracefully and can be grounded in a knowledge base via RAG, making them genuinely useful for customer support, internal helpdesks and self-service portals.

A good chatbot is measured not just on deflection rate but also on customer satisfaction, task completion and clean handover to humans when it hits its limits.

Why It Matters

Business relevance for UK organisations

UK SMEs deploy chatbots to cover out-of-hours support, deflect routine queries and qualify inbound leads — typically at 10–20% of the cost of additional human headcount.
